Platform Database Engineer
Summary
Platform Database Engineer at Betsson Group in Budapest (hybrid: 3 office days/week) building and running database hosting platforms as code within a global tech ecosystem. Day to day: administering AWS SQL/NoSQL DBaaS and PostgreSQL/SQL Server fleets, provisioning with Terraform/Ansible, monitoring with Prometheus/Grafana, and tuning performance and scale.
